Late night TV host and comedian Stephen Colbert was spotted around Flat Rock this past weekend.

On Saturday, Colbert tweeted a photo of himself at the Carl Sandburg Home national historic site in Flat Rock. Colbert also visited the Flat Rock Village Bakery, stopping to pose for a photo with the owner. He was also seen at the local Kilwin’s, according to another social media post.

The Hendersonville Lightning online news site reported several sightings of Colbert in the area.

On his Twitter account, which has some 14 million followers, Colbert was encouraging people to share photos of their July Fourth celebrations with the hashtag #AmericanGreatness.
